Turning On Burglary Protection 
Turning on burglary protection will probably be the most used (and most 
important) operation for most sites. Take extra time to practice securing and 
exiting your premises. Make sure other operators you depend on for site 
closings do the same. 
If the operating panel is located within the protected area, you must enter 
and exit the premises through a pre-determined entry/exit door. If your 
system is programmed with an audible exit delay warning, the operating 
panel will beep (once every second) during the exit delay period. You must 
exit the protected area and close the exit door securely before the exit delay 
expires. A 4-second steady tone indicates the expiration of the exit delay. If 
you are detained and hear the 4-second tone, return to the operating panel, 
re-enter your ID code, and repeat the process for exiting. If there is no exit 
delay warning programmed for the group you are in, but you are arming 
multiple groups, some of which have exit delay warning, you will hear the 
exit delay warning at your keypad. 
Note: If you do not exit the protected area prior to the expiration of the exit 
delay, an “exit fail” signal will be transmitted to the ADT Customer 
Monitoring Center. 
The system can be turned on in either the AWAY or STAY mode. The STAY 
mode automatically bypasses certain point types. Check with your ADT 
service technician to see if your system contains any of these point types.
